Oyster plate from Proceram - vintage yellow earthenware from the 1950s
Beautiful oyster plate from Proceram in a warm yellow shade, made in France in the 1950s. The plate holds six oysters and is a fine example of mid-20th century French ceramic design.
Proceram was known for its durable and decorative earthenware plates that were used both privately and in restaurants.
